It's only the halfway logical choice. Even if he beats Fitch, BJ has not done enough to earn the title. Two wins does not do that for any fighter, with the exception of a title holder going to a different weight. On the other hand, who else is there? Fitch is the obvious choice to fight for the title, but Shields will have just lost, Kos just lost, Kampmann just lost, Sanchez isn't ready, Alves lost recently (and it's too soon for an Alves v Fitch 3), Lytle just lost, but Ebersole isn't ready, Ellenberger isn't ready either. I guess it would have to be BJ v Fitch for the title and while I do want to see that rematch, I don't think it has enough drama behind it for a memorable title fight.
If GSP left, and that's the fight that determined a champion, nobody would fully respect the new champion. Unfortunately the UFC is opposed to tournaments, which would make the new champion more meaningful.
